LITTLE ROCK, Ark. - Mississippi Valley State swept Lyon and Philander Smith in a tri-match on Saturday in Little Rock, Ark. Valley defeated Lyon 3-2 (25-21, 23-24, 13-25, 25-22, 15-12) before blanking Philander Smith, 3-0 (25-12, 25-13, 25-17).
Lonnie Huff totaled 34 kills and 13 digs on the day to pace the Devilettes. Maura Moed contributed 27 kills, eight blocks and six aces.

ATLANTA, Ga. - The Georgia Tech volleyball team (1-1) swept Alabama A&M (0-2), 3-0 (25-11, 25-15, 25-14), Saturday afternoon at O'Keefe Gym in the Courtyard Marriott Classic.
The Bulldogs dropped its nightcap to the Indiana Hoosiers, 3-0 (25-13, 25-13, 25-11).

JONESBORO, Ark. - Arkansas-Pine Bluff wrapped up action at the ASU Invite with a 3-0 (25-17, 25-15, and 25-15) loss to Northwestern State on Saturday.
Kourtney Adams led NSU with 10 kills and a .529 attack percentage. UAPB was held to a .071 attack percentage as it managed just 16 kills on 56 attacks with 12 attacking errors.

JACKSON, Miss. - North Texas slipped past Jackson State, 3-1 (27-25, 20-25, 25-23, 25-13) in Saturday afternoon action at the Jackson State Invitational.
The Lady Tigers improved their record to 2-2 with a 3-1 (20-25, 25-23, 25-21, 25-18) victory over Louisiana-Monroe in the tournament finale.
Against ULM, Chyna Coleman led all players with 18 kills, LaToya Clark posted a match-high 40 assists and Teri Braddock added 19 digs. The Tigers out-hit ULM .181 to .092 for the match and also won the battle at the net with 10 blocks compared to eight by the Warhawks.
